Abstract
Geostatistics, based on regionalized variable theorem incorporating the
spatial or temporal characteristics of actual data into statistical estimation
processes to do linear unbiased estimation or simulation, is widely applied in
many fields included social and natural study. Combining geostatistical
techniques and geographic information system may not only provide the basic
functions of geographic information system, but also improve the functions of
spatial information analysis and estimation to realize spatial variations,
dependences, estimation and simulation of spatial data, especially to improve the
ability of decision making support of geographic information system.
Therefore, in this project, we first review the geostatistical methods and
algorithms to select suitable, useful and applicable geostatistical methods which
are the bases of the geostatistical components of the geographic information
system SuperGIS. A number of test examples also set up to evaluate the
performances of the components comparing to most popular geostatistical
software. SuperGeo Technologies Inc. performed the coding the algorithm
components, user interface and functional modules. The performances of these
codes reported and feedback to designer in the SuperGeo Inc.. Final, this team
produces high performance geostaistical components for SuperGoe which is a
native Geographic information system in Taiwan.
